Development and Communications - Community Disaster Education Presenter Purpose: To provide disaster education and disaster preparedness information to companies, organizations, clubs and schools Key Responsibilities: ●Conduct and manage presentations in a professional environment ●Equip students and participants with vital knowledge of disasters and how to prepare and react to them ●Answer questions regarding the American Red Cross-High Desert Chapter Qualifications: ●Interest in people and the ability to work well with volunteers and paid staff ●Thorough knowledge of the Mission, Fundamental Principles, history and services of the American Red Cross ●Strong communication and interpersonal skills ●Basic computer skills ●Ability to provide quality customer service ●Knowledge of general office protocol, procedures and equipment ●Professional appearance and manner ●Bi-lingual Spanish/English as plus Training/Criteria: ●Complete Volunteer Application ●Complete online background check ●Complete New Employment and Volunteer Orientation ●Complete fulfilling the Mission training course ●On the job training as necessary
